3. Preparing for hacking
Advances in artificial intelligence and machine learning have given attackers new tools to trick alert employees into giving up valuable information. ChatGPT allows anyone to write legitimate-looking messages, and new deepfake technology has created the threat of highly convincing phishing attacks using audio and video footage.

Increasingly, organizations need to plan for when — not if — they will suffer a breach. CIOs and CISOs should work together to promote data security best practices at all levels of the business. Agree that data worth keeping has a business purpose. And use techniques like anonymization, encryption, or tokenization to protect existing data and make it useless if stolen.

From a leadership perspective, help business leaders understand the risks associated with data, especially business-critical and sensitive personal information, and the importance of protecting all valuable data.

4. Actions in the context of reduced resources and budgets
Companies facing budget cuts and layoffs have fewer resources and fewer people to do the same amount of work. While this may require making tough decisions about what to cut, don’t rush into making any decisions. It’s worth determining whether current operations are as efficient as possible or whether there are ways to improve the way the company handles day-to-day processes.

Determining efficiency depends on what data routine operations generate. For example, some functions may generate timestamps that can be used to determine the efficiency of those processes. Monitor changes in each process by reviewing timestamp data to identify potential improvements.

Further efficiency gains are possible through automation. To automate processes, companies need to understand the flow of data in existing operational procedures. Building automation on this foundation allows for maximum efficiency gains with minimal risk. Once your organization has optimized efficiency where possible, decide what cuts still need to be made.
